In our part of Merced County it is fair time!  We have always enjoyed our small town fair and we are proud supporters of the Merced County Spring Fair Heritage Foundation.

We feel our fair is unique, in that it did not start as a fair at all, but a picnic gathering by the late Henry Miller a pioneer and visionary in our area.  Henry Miller, of the Miller and Lux Company, was a cattleman, and the first to develop an organized irrigation system in our area.  It is said that he could drive cattle from Mexico to Oregon and rest and graze his cattle on his own land every night.

We are grateful for pioneers such as Henry Miller and celebrate his legacy at our small town fair.

The Merced County Spring Fair Heritage Foundation that we support was created out of necessity when the state pulled funding from fairs such as ours.  With the broad  support of business people and families in the area we have been able to keep our fair for future generations of 4-H and FFA kids to learn the responsibilities and hard work it takes to work in agriculture.
